Transcription of SUPREME COURT OF ILLINOIS

1 SUPREME COURT OF ILLINOIS . Administrative Office of the ILLINOIS Courts PROBLEM-SOLVING COURTS. STANDARDS. November 2015 . Michael J. Tardy, Director ACKNOWLEDGEMENT. In March 2013, at the direction of the ILLINOIS SUPREME COURT , the Administrative Office of the ILLINOIS Courts and the Special SUPREME COURT Advisory Committee for Justice and Mental Health Planning initiated development of uniform standards and a framework for an application and certification process for all ILLINOIS problem- solving courts. The committee created a Working Group to facilitate the drafting process.

2 Gratitude and appreciation is extended to the members of the Advisory Committee for their commitment and contribution to this project.
